How TikTok Live Notifications Work
TikTok uses a complex delivery system for live alerts. Unlike 1-to-1 messages, Live notifications are batched. The algorithm decides who gets notified first based on your engagement levels, app activity, and device permissions.
Tiered Priority
Notifications are sent in waves, meaning you might be 15 minutes late.
Silent Mode Triggers
iOS and Android often suppress TikTok alerts to save battery life.
Quick Setup
- 1 Open the TikTok App
- 2 Go to Profile > Settings
- 3 Tap "Notifications"
- 4 Select "Live Notification Settings"
- 5 Toggle "All" for Creators
iPhone Settings
iOS 19+ prioritizes "Focus Modes". To ensure delivery, go to Settings > Notifications > TikTok and enable Critical Alerts and Time-Sensitive Notifications.
Android Optimization
Android 16 requires you to whitelist TikTok. Go to Settings > Apps > TikTok > Battery and select "Unrestricted" to prevent the OS from killing the background service.
Why Notifications Sometimes Fail
Notification Overload
When you have 50+ apps, the OS starts suppressing "lower priority" social alerts.
Battery Optimization
Power-saving modes stop apps from checking for live status in the background.
Time Zone Gaps
Sleep schedules and "Do Not Disturb" often block alerts during peak global streaming hours.
Network Latency
Momentary connection drops can cause the notification push token to expire or fail.
